The term "talion" derives from the Latin word "talis" or "tale" it means identical or similar, so that it does not refer to an equivalent penalty but an identical penalty. The best-known expression of the law of retaliation is "eye for an eye, tooth for a tooth" appeared in the old testament exodus.Historically, constitutes the first attempt to establish a proportionality between damage taken in a crime and damage in the punishment, thus being the first limit to revenge.
